Kaisu Määttä is a scholar working on Biochemistry, Molecular Biology and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Kaisu Määttä has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 946 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Biochemistry, 5 papers in Molecular Biology and 5 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Kaisu Määttä’s work include Phytochemicals and Antioxidant Activities (7 papers), Berry genetics and cultivation research (3 papers) and Plant Gene Expression Analysis (3 papers). Kaisu Määttä is often cited by papers focused on Phytochemicals and Antioxidant Activities (7 papers), Berry genetics and cultivation research (3 papers) and Plant Gene Expression Analysis (3 papers). Kaisu Määttä collaborates with scholars based in Finland and Sweden. Kaisu Määttä's co-authors include Afaf Kamal‐Eldin, Riitta Törrönen, Anneli Törrönen, Sirpa Kärenlampi, Laura Jaakola, Anja Hohtola, Anna Maria Pirttilä, Hanna Kokko, Reijo Karjalainen and Anne Hukkanen and has published in prestigious journals such as PLANT PHYSIOLOGY,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ry and Antioxidants and Redox Signaling.
